Launch at the main beachhead at 8-8:30 am. High tide of 6.2 at 8:30 am low at 3:30pm -.2

Last weekend 2 were caught by shore anglers at the spot just south of the beach according to a report on coastside. They may have moved down into San Pablo a bit with the last rain. Hope they are still there. Company welcome. Its not a real big outgo but at 6+ft you should have done this once to be safe. Thanks, Craig. As always, weather permitting.
